    Descriptions

  • 1.

    Heat canola o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add eggs and cook, stirring, until curds are light and fluffy, 2 to 3 minutes, transfer to a plate. Add bacon to skillet and cook until crisp, 5 to 6 minutes. 

  • 2.

    Add pepper, scallion whites, and carrots, and cook, stirring occasionally, until soft, 5 to 6 minutes. Add garlic and ginger and cook until fragrant, 1 to 2 minutes.

  • 3.

    Reduce heat to medium-low and add peas and rice. Cook, stirring occasionally, until warmed through, 4 to 5 minutes. Fold in eggs and season with soy sauce and sesame oil. Serve immediately topped with scallion greens and more sesame oil alongside.
